Mission Statement
Our AmeriCorps Senior Demonstration Program aims to recruit, train and place AmeriCorps Seniors volunteers in respite-related positions throughout Lewis, Oneida, Herkimer, Cortland, Tompkins, and Jefferson Counties in New York State. What is respite? Respite is simply a break. In this case, volunteers provide short-term relief for caregivers of older adults and people with disabilities. Volunteers will be trained, mentored and supported, and could move from a stipend program to a paid respite workforce if they choose.
Description
The New York State Caregiving & Respite Coalition, NYSCRC, is a partnership of dedicated organizations and individuals committed to supporting the millions of our state's family caregivers. NYSCRC members understand the unique needs of caregivers. Through training and education, we focus on increasing caregivers' access to respite resources. And we speak with a unified voice to gain the attention of policymakers for the needs of family caregivers.
